Police are appealing for witnesses of a collision between a car and cyclist in Gamlingay yesterday.

The incident, which happened at about 11.55pm in Heath Road, involved a blue Rover 45 being driven by a 28-year-old man from Gamlingay and a cyclist from Bedfordshire who is in his 40s.

The cyclist was taken to Addenbrooke’s Hospital in Cambridge with serious injuries but today was in a stable condition.

Anyone who saw the collision or either vehicle involved just prior should contact the Collision Investigation Unit on 101.
